Revolutionary War Soldier

Lieutenant
William Brandon

A Patriot of the American Revolution
Biography

9/1/1775, a Lieutenant under Capt. George Davidson for three years.

Official records claim he resigned 3/8/1776.

In his Pension Application, he asserts that he served between two and three years.

From Rowan County, NC.

Later a Private in the NC Militia.

aka William Brannon.

S3082.

Battle Records

Great Cane Brake (SC), Snow Campaign (SC).
At Moore's Creek Bridge [4]
